Steelers LB T.J. Watt clashes with Pittsburgh radio personality

First off, everyone knows Pittsburgh radio personality Mark Madden is a blowhard. He lives the life of the heel in Pittsburgh and loves to stir up people, especially when it comes to the Pittsburgh Steelers.

Madden’s latest move was to put on Twitter that Steelers linebacker T.J. Watt skipped his exit interview at the end of the season and seemed disgruntled. A claim Watt openly denied on Twitter as well. Madden then doubled down even after hearing from Watt and stood by his source.

This is classic Madden. He is an old-school fan and hates what he feels like the team has become. This is all about getting listeners for his radio show. His source was likely wrong but this is the hill he will choose to die on. Watt has never had any character concerns so it doesn’t make any sense why he would start now.
